A NEW fitness station on Coffs Harbour’s Southern Foreshores comes as a welcomed new addition to the Coffs Harbour waterfront.

The new equipment installed as part of the Wayne Glenn Walk has been made possible through the community work of the Rotary Club of Coffs Harbour.

“I congratulate the Rotary Club of Coffs Harbour membership for driving this important project, and for delivering it,” Member for Coffs Harbour Gurmesh Singh said on Friday.

“In consultation with local organisations, Rotary identified the need to provide an opportunity for all members of our community to have free access to fitness equipment.

“The Southern Foreshores Fitness Station creates an exercise and meeting point for individuals and community groups. While they enjoy getting fit, they can also enjoy the stunning harbourside views.”

The project accessed $16,000 from the NSW Government’s Community Building Partnership Program.

“(This) is designed to help create a more vibrant and inclusive local community with positive social, environment and recreation outcomes,” he said.

The Southern Foreshores Fitness Station complements a host of Rotary projects, which are designed to enhance the Coffs Harbour Jetty Foreshores.
